Understanding Reliance's Real Estate Strategy
Reliance Industries approaches real estate development as a strategic business vertical rather than a core focus area. This positioning allows them to be highly selective about projects, locations, and market segments they enter, typically focusing on premium developments that align with their corporate brand values.
Unlike traditional real estate developers who depend entirely on property sales for revenue, Reliance's diversified business portfolio provides financial stability that translates into conservative project planning and execution. This approach reduces the typical risks associated with developer financial stress or market downturns.
Their real estate ventures often integrate with other Reliance businesses, creating synergies in retail, telecommunications, and digital services that enhance the overall value proposition for residents and investors.

Reliance Real Estate Portfolio Analysis
Premium Development Focus
Reliance's real estate projects typically target the ultra-premium segment, with developments that reflect their corporate standards for quality and execution. These projects often feature in prime locations across major metropolitan cities, particularly Mumbai and the NCR region.
Their developments emphasize quality over quantity, with each project receiving significant attention to design, construction standards, and long-term value creation. This approach results in limited inventory but exceptional quality that justifies premium pricing.
The projects often incorporate smart building technologies, sustainable design principles, and integrated services that reflect Reliance's expertise in technology and infrastructure development.
Integrated Township Concepts
Where Reliance has ventured into larger developments, they have focused on creating integrated townships that combine residential, commercial, retail, and recreational components. This approach leverages their experience in managing complex business operations and creates self-contained communities.
These townships often feature advanced infrastructure including fiber optic connectivity, smart utilities management, and integrated security systems that exceed typical residential project standards.
The commercial components within these developments are typically leased to established businesses or Reliance group companies, ensuring quality tenants and stable revenue streams that support long-term project viability.
